autoit中文站人才济济。顽固不化老兄的一个小程序的yy版。
此为顽固不化老兄的au3
可以获取长路径:
[au3]
#NoTrayIcon
if $cmdlineraw<>"" Then
;MsgBox(0,"测试信息(pcbar)","该文件的完整路径为:"&@LF&@LF&$cmdline[1])
ClipPut (FileGetLongName($cmdline[1]))
Exit
EndIf
$a=MsgBox(32+4+4096+262144,'拷贝路径到粘贴板','提示,请问是否添加右键菜单?点"是"将添加,点"否"将删除!')
if $a=6 Then
RegWrite("HKCR\*\SHELL\拷贝路径到粘贴板(&C)\command","","REG_SZ",@ScriptFullPath&" %1")
Else
RegDelete("HKCR\*\SHELL\拷贝路径到粘贴板(&C)")
EndIf
[/au3]
|
大家可以测试下,对于一般的没有空格的文件是没有问题的。对于名称中包含空格的,则不能完整的提取了。琢磨了下,很好玩。修正好了。so,不是{bfb}原创。只是yy了下。
特此声明。
【暂不支持文件夹】
易盘下载:
文件名称:
复制路径yy.exe
文件介绍:
==============================